Growing up I never like brussel sprouts but I think I finally cracked that code these honey bomic Sprouts were so good crispy sweet you got to try it let’s get into it first things first get one pound of fresh brussels sprouts now their Frozen stuff and give them a good wash

And dry next preheat your oven to 400° f with the bacon tray inside now you want to remove any hanging skin cut the ends off and then cut them in half just like this and add them to a large mixing bowl we’re going to hit them with some oeo

Then we got garlic powder on powdered salt some white pepper some balsamic vinegar and some honey give that a nice mix for this and many other amazing recipes check out the link in my bio for my cookbook once everything is Thoroughly mixed bring out your heated

Bacon tray add some oil you want to place your Brussels face side down just like this from here we’re going to bake it at 400° fhe for 25 to 30 minutes folks plate up I hit it with a balsamic glaze so good
